Interesting; thanks for posting. I wouldn't consider these until they have proper M3 sizes. They don't have "our" sizes as you stated above. They have a 265/30/19 for the rear which is 1" smaller than the proper M3 size. They do also have 305/30/19 which would fit with the right wheel size/offset but the only option for the front is 245/35/19 or 265/30/19 which would work but not ideal... Too much stagger IMO.

Got it, but has this improvement vs PSC or vs rivals been proven out in unbiased testing? Right now it seems to be out in so few sizes and with so few reviews that it's hard to get a guage of how good a tire it really is. Also the fact that it's unavailable in any 18" sizes seems odd, and probably eliminates it from track contention for a lot of drivers right now. For the moment, it seems like Michelin is focused more on the OE market for the PSC2, which may or may not translate to a great track tire.

I remember sitting through a tire demonstration from Michelin, and they talk about some combination blend of silica and organic oil (they use sun-flower seed oil) in the rubber compound dramatically improves wet performance without sacrificing dry grip.
I'm surprised that not more of you E9X M3 guys run 275/40/R18 size. There are a ton of brands available for it. I've got 4x Maxxis RC-1s in that size on my MZ4 Coupe.
